Transaction c3dc7b67f53ef472f8552448d99d54ef7971b8d160a751065cb2c5f6046aed14
2 Input
2 Outputs
- c3dc7b67f53ef472f8552448d99d54ef7971b8d160a751065cb2c5f6046aed14:0
- c3dc7b67f53ef472f8552448d99d54ef7971b8d160a751065cb2c5f6046aed14:1
value 17201898
address 3HFeVH5KksLDadmqo37yZhGCu5w7YAcAKh
value 945269
address 1HoELg8nEDo3KU274cAcQr1MD2RFpAyeRr